問題タブ [xmlnode]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
c# - XElementをXmlNodeに変換する
直接的な方法はありませんが、それでも..XElement
要素をに変換できますかXmlNode
。InnerText
およびのようなオプションInnerXml
は XmlNode
特定のものです。
XElement
したがって、これらのオプションを使用したい場合は、に変換するために何ができるか、 XmlNode
またはその逆を行うことができます。
c# - XPATHヘルプ:XPathNodeIteratorを使用して名前空間でXMLノードを検索する
このXMLファイルで必要なノードを取得するための適切なXPATH構文を見つけるのに問題があります。1つは、XMLにNameSPaceがないため、コードに1つ追加する必要があります。これは私のXPATHに影響すると思います。
次のようなXMLファイルがあります。
したがって、XPATHの場合、「CONFIGURATION」要素で「NAme」NODE値を取得する場合は、次のXPATHを使用すると想定します。
しかし時々私はそれにns:を追加する必要があります:
そして、私は次のように要素値を見つけることができます:
しかし、これは私にはまったく機能していません。どのxpathを試しても、XMLに値は見つかりません。これが私のコードです:
問題が発生したり、Xpath構文について提案したりできますか?
ありがとう。
php - PHP で XML NODE を処理する方法
ここに簡単なコードがあります。によって返されるノードを処理する方法を知りたいだけです$reader->expand();
c# - xmlnodereaderからxmlnodeを取得するにはどうすればよいですか
私はicecatシートを1つの巨大なxmlドキュメント(1.7g)として読んでおり、xmlnodereaderを使用しています。
ノードごとに読み取るにはどうすればよいですか。私は、通常、あなたはこれをしないだろうと知っていますが、構造は次のようになります
参照用の既存のコードは次のとおりです。
asp.net - WebサービスメソッドはXmlDocumentを返し、リファレンスはXmlNodeを参照します
解決できない問題に直面したので、助けてください!私はWebServiceを使用していて、次のようなGetSystemDocumentというWebServiceメソッドからXmlDocumentを返そうとしています。
このWebサービスを参照するプロジェクトで。Visual Studioは、タイプ'System.Xml.XmlNode'を'System.Xml.XmlDocument'に暗黙的に変換できないと言っています。
Reference.csファイル(Visual Studioによって生成された)を調べると、コードは次のようになります。
問題はそこにあります。XmlNodeの代わりにXmlDocumentが表示されるはずです。手動で編集すると、ビルドされ、すべてが正常に機能します。
IISをリセットし、参照を更新し、Webサービスを再構築してみました。誰かが解決策を持っていますか?
これは答えられていない同様の質問です。
どうもありがとう
xml - jspでJSTL XMLタグを使用してノードセット内のXMLノードの数を数えることは可能ですか?
以下のxmlから本のノードの数を数えようとしています:
JSP ページ内で XPath の count 関数を使用してみましたが、5 ではなく 0 (ブック ノードの数) が返されます。
jspでjstl xmlタグを使用してブックノードの数を取得する方法を教えてください。
ありがとう、
金星
xml - AS3:単一の一致の場合、XPathはXMLListではなくXMLNodeを返しますか?
AS3
XMLファイルに基づいて画像を動的にロードしようとしています。Imがこだわった問題は、指定された識別子から見つかったノードを返すことになっている関数です。次のコードのように
XMLは次のようになります。
あなたの質問を予想して、XMLがロードされると、それはすべてxmlローダーのCOMPLETEイベントで行われます。
ここで問題となるのは、XMLが空であるように見えても、xmlが正しく入力されており、識別子がノードの1つと確実に一致していることです。クエリされたノードを複製すると、リストは2つのノードを含むものとして正しくトレースされます。したがって、一致するものが1つしかない場合、XMLListは作成されず、結果にはXMLNodeデータ型のデータが含まれると思います。
これを確認する人はいますか?もしそうなら、クエリが常にXMLListタイプを返すようにする方法はありますか?
ありがとうArtur
c# - 手動で処理される SOAP 送信 - XmlNode: NodeTypes および Attributes read only
Web サービスを呼び出す必要がありますが、xml を手動で作成する必要があります。これを行うためにSystem.Xmlを選択しましたが、それは私に多くの苦痛を引き起こしています。
私が知っているすべての SOAP は、次の 3 つの部分で構成されています。
- Xml宣言
- エンベロープのヘッダーまたは SOAP-ENV:Envelope
- エンベロープの本文または SOAP-ENV:Body
問題は、私の XmlDocument には 1 つのルート要素しか含めることができないということです。(理由がわからない) もし私がそうするなら
属性を追加できません。それらは読み取り専用であると言われています。
再開:
ルートなしで XmlDeclaration を使用してこれを記述するにはどうすればよいですか? また、Web サービスを (この xml で) 呼び出すにはどうすればよいですか?
これが私が接続しているwsdlです
c# - XmlNodeをXmlElementに追加します
名前や住所などの顧客データが記載された石鹸の封筒をWebサービスから受け取ります。住所には市/郊外ではなく郵便番号が含まれています。私はすべての市と郊外の郵便番号をCSVファイルに入れているので、各郵便番号に正しい名前を挿入したいと思います。データベースなどに保存できますが、これはデータを渡す前にノードを挿入する方法に関するものです。
コードは次のようなものです:
コードをコメントアウトした場所で何をすべきかわかりません。助言がありますか?これをより効率的にするためのヒントもいただければ幸いです。
前もって感謝します。